Transaction 774c5d556775a900e584a625207ca8c477c47ca1c6fe94518dbcf5d5c683ac5b
1 Input
1 Outputs
- 774c5d556775a900e584a625207ca8c477c47ca1c6fe94518dbcf5d5c683ac5b:0
value 5000010000
address mpcbHeipD6bWBvxRADWA8wVMp6ntDpYHU1